Can't decide between chocolate or peanut butter? No need to choose with this tasty spread made from equal parts of each. Simply melt and blend and use like you would peanut butter.

1 pound peanut butter
1 pound milk chocolate
Combine the peanut butter and milk chocolate in the top of a double boiler over simmering, not boiling, water.
Stir the mixture until completely smooth and melted.
Pour into a container and let set until room temperature.
Use like you would peanut butter.
You can substitute almond butter for the peanut butter, and/or semisweet chocolate for the milk chocolate.
